Long Island Elementary School is a public prek-5 school.
We accept tuition students. This is a public school that accepts students from outside districts.
We also accept students during shoulder-season for seasonal renters who want to extend their time on the island. Inquire today about enrolling your student for the fall or spring!

Learning starts after students board the ferry at Casco Bay Lines ferry terminal in Portland, ME.
While many students spend their time on a bus, Long Island students use the ocean and the ferry as their classroom during their 40 minute commute to Long Island.
Students are accompanied by a “Sea Nanny,” who begins the day’s instruction while on the water and supervises the children’s commute.
Once they arrive at Long Island, a school bus picks up the students and transports them three minutes to the Long Island School.

We are a public school accepting tuitioned students. Tuition to the Long Island School is $8500, which is significantly less expensive than many private schools in the area.
